Original fynbos
Sugarbird® Original Fynbos Gin’s floral-forward profile has top notes of rose geranium, the Cape May flower, and a subtle hint of buchu all native to the Cape Fynbos region. These are complemented by orange blossom, Angelica root and other fynbos botanicals for a perfectly rounded, balanced gin.
Juniper unfiltered
Sugarbird® Juniper Unfiltered Gin showcases the rich purple hue of female juniper cones in Africa’s first unfiltered gin. The full personality of juniper is complemented by an array of unique floral fynbos botanicals including Scarlet Erica, Cape Chamomile, and Cape May. Pink grapefruit peel provides a fresh citrus note to round off the distinct flavours of this showstopper gin.
Pino & Pelaraonium
Sugarbird® Pino & Pelargonium Gin celebrates two of South Africa’s finest botanical exports. Pinotage grape skins impart a vibrant pink blush, while a trio of Pelargonium species (fynbos known globally as Geranium) drives the citrus and floral character. The Rose variety adds floral sweetness, Lemon brings a crispness and African Geranium’s deep red root tuber brings colour and medicinal benefits. The result is a fragrant gin with perfectly balanced natural sweetness.
Honeybush & Moringa
Sugarbird® Honeybush & Moringa Gin blends the natural sweetness of honeybush with the tart, herbaceous character of Namibian Moringa. Trickle-filtered through honeybush and rooibos leaves, this amber gin exudes warm toffee, woody undertones, and aromatic spiciness. A celebration of African botanicals, it offers a distinctive, flavourful gin experience.
Cape Holly & Wild Plum
This unique gin marries the sweet and tart flavours of two trees native to South Africa. The succulent red berries from Ilex mitis (Cape Holly) and Harpephyllum caffrum (Wild Plum) are extracted and blended to craft a tangy, plum-infused gin with a natural sweetness that promises to transport you to the heart of the South African landscape with every sip.

Juniper Unfiltered
- Awards: 2023 Gold Aurora International Tasting Challenge, 2023 Silver Vitis Vinifera Awards
- Botanicals: Juniper, Cape Chamomile, Cape May, Burgundy Sunset, South African Geranium, Namibian myrrh
- Nose : Top notes of Juniper followed by wonderful citrus aromas. Rounded out by fresh floral notes from Rose Geranium and sweet Crimson-eyed Hibiscus
- Palate : Offers the full personality of Juniper - paying homage to the pure essence at the core of gin - with signature fynbos botanicals, Cape Chamomile and Cape May adding subtle complexity. Subtle hints of blueberry
- Finish : A juniper-forward finish with undertones of Pink Grapefruit
- Pairs well with: duck and other game meat.

Pino & Pelaraonium
- Awards: 2022 Double Award for The Merit wine and spirit challenge, 2022 Gold for The Rosé Wine and Spirit Challenge
- Pinotage, a South African signature red wine grape varietal that adds a vibrant pink colour, while one of three different types of Pelargonium (a Cape fynbos, known globally as Geranium), Rose Pelargonium or Geranium adds a sweet, floral flavour.
- Botanicals : Juniper, Angelica root, Cardamon, Honeybush, Pinotage, Rose Geranium, Lemon Geranium, African Geranium
- Nose : Enticing floral and aromatic, balanced by fresh pine from Juniper and layers of lemony mint
- Palate: Soft yet sweet-like, floral front of the palate is achieved by the layers of Pelargonium. Rose Geranium starts with its signature rose-water, Turkish delight-like sweet spice. Lemon Geranium compliments familiar juniper notes, adding a touch of refreshing citrus.
- Finish : Pinotage notes create a striking finish and fragrant floral flavours from Pelargonium round off this lightly sweet, rosy, refreshing gin
- Pairs well with: fresh seasonal summer fruits and berries, with added ice cream for extra sweetness

Honeybush & Moringa
- Awards: 2023 Gold Aurora International Tasting Challenge, 2023 Bronze for The Trophy Spirits Show
- This floral-driven amber gin is trickle-filtered through the leaves of the honeybush (Cyclopia) and rooibos (Aspalathus) plants, adding warm toffee and woody notes, for subtle aromatic spiciness.
- The natural sweetness of Honeybush is beautifully balanced by Namibian Moringa, which brings its own tart, herbaceous characteristics.
- Botanicals: Juniper, Coriander, Cape Fynbos, Confetti Bush, Honeybush, Rooibos, African Moringa
- Nose: Lovely rich malty molasses aroma - very enticing with juniper malty molasses aroma with Honeybush evident.
- Palate: Buttery toffee warm, with hints of Honeybush added with restraint. Aromatic, spicy, with undertones of sweet toffee and honeyed Rooibos.
- Finish: Honeybush finish with lingering spicy notes. A Juniper finish meets a Rooibos African feel.
- Pairs well with: a charcuterie platter, salmon blinis with a homemade creme fraise.
